The global automotive emergency braking system (AEBS) market is poised for robust growth, projected to expand from USD 36.86 billion in 2025 to USD 75.99 billion by 2035, at a CAGR of 7.5%. This acceleration is fueled by the rapid adoption of advanced driver assistance systems (ADAS), stricter government safety regulations, and rising consumer awareness regarding vehicle safety technologies.

Automotive emergency braking systems are becoming a cornerstone of modern vehicle safety, with regulators, automakers, and technology providers aligning efforts to make the feature standard across passenger cars, commercial fleets, and electric vehicles. Recent studies confirm that AEB reduces rear-end collisions by nearly 50%, reinforcing its role as a critical enabler of safer mobility. As sensor costs continue to decline and AI integration improves decision-making, AEBS is transitioning from a premium feature to a baseline safety requirement worldwide

Market Trends Highlighted

  • Regulatory Push Enhances Adoption: In April 2024, the U.S. National Highway Traffic Safety Administration (NHTSA) finalized Federal Motor Vehicle Safety Standard No. 127, mandating AEB systems in all new passenger vehicles and light trucks by 2029. Similar regulatory frameworks in Europe, Japan, and South Korea are reinforcing the adoption of AEBS across mainstream and premium vehicle categories.
  • Technological Advancements in Sensor Fusion: Multi-sensor fusion, combining radar, LiDAR, and camera systems, accounted for 36% of the market in 2025 and is projected to grow at a CAGR of 7.9%. Improved data processing and AI-enabled algorithms allow AEBS to function in challenging conditions, such as low visibility and high-speed highway traffic.
  • Expansion Beyond Passenger Cars: OEMs and logistics firms are increasingly adopting AEBS in commercial vehicles and heavy-duty trucks to reduce accident risks and comply with stringent safety mandates. This diversification is expected to unlock new growth opportunities through 2035.
  • Forward Emergency Braking Dominates Applications: Representing 58% of the market share in 2025, forward emergency braking remains the most widely deployed AEBS application. Its role in preventing frontal collisions makes it a core ADAS feature across ICE vehicles, EVs, and connected vehicle platforms.
  • EV and Autonomous Integration: As electrification accelerates, high-speed emergency braking is becoming a standard feature in electric crossovers and autonomous prototypes, contributing to Vision Zero road safety initiatives worldwide.

Regional Market Outlook

  • United States: With NHTSA mandating AEB in all vehicles by 2029, the U.S. market is projected to grow at a CAGR of 7.8%. Automakers such as Tesla, GM, and Ford are integrating radar- and camera-supported AEBS across models, supported by V2X communication and smart city infrastructure.
  • Europe: The European Union market will expand at a CAGR of 7.6%, driven by UNECE Regulation No. 152 and EU General Safety Regulations mandating AEBS in all new vehicles. OEMs like Volkswagen, BMW, and Stellantis are scaling LiDAR- and AI-powered braking technologies.
  • United Kingdom: Expected CAGR of 7.4%, boosted by government safety initiatives and rapid EV adoption. Automakers such as Jaguar Land Rover and Nissan are embedding predictive AI-powered braking into their electric platforms.
  • Japan: Growing at a CAGR of 7.7%, supported by JNCAP mandates requiring AEBS in all new models by 2025. Leading OEMs Toyota, Honda, and Nissan are focusing on predictive braking analytics and multi-camera solutions for urban safety.
  • South Korea: Projected CAGR of 7.5%, supported by MOLIT regulations mandating AEB from 2025. Hyundai and Kia are deploying AI-enhanced AEBS powered by the country’s advanced semiconductor and V2X communication ecosystem.
